Final Project - Initial Ideas

 


Theme: Justice

Traditional Media: Performance Art

New Media: Video/Editing

For my final project, I am tempted to do a continuation of my Blank Assignment—integrating performance, video, as well as elements of the stop-motion project. I am excited for the theme of Justice, as social justice and education is something I am passionate about, as well as the fact that I can integrate what I have been learning in our Diversity and Equity class. I’d like to make commentary on issues affecting Latinx communities in the US, particularly those of deportation, displacement, and/or environmentalism. 

I’d like to also utilize the stop-motion format, but do it in color and with more frames than I did in the Blank Assignment so that it reads as less stop motion, and more video. I’d like to challenge myself to sync up audio including music and voiceover/song to the video, rather than just using music and sound effects like I did in my previous video/stop-motion assignments. 

I have a lot of experience with editing videos, however, I’d like to lean more into more complex video editing.
